Whooping Cough -- Spain
The Ministry of Health of Castilla-La Mancha, through the Director-General of Public Health, has confirmed a family-based outbreak of pertussis in the province of Guadalajara.
This outbreak affected the parents and 2 children. The parents are of Moroccan origin and unknown vaccination status.
